About the Course

Enterprise JavaBeans (EJB) are the distributed component model of Java 2 Enterprise Edition (J2EE). EJBs let you create highly scalable, maintainable systems that use transactions for data integrity. This course will give you a solid fundamental understanding of the EJB technology and as well as the skills you need to architect and code systems that use EJBs. Here is a list of topics:

  1. Introduction to Distributed Objects
  2. RMI Overview
  3. EJB Architecture, Part 1
  4. EJB Architecture, Part 2
  5. Stateless Session Beans
  6. Stateful Session Beans
  7. Entity Bean Concepts, Part 1
  8. Container-Managed Persistence Entity Beans
  9. Entity Bean Concepts, Part 2
  10. Introduction to JDBC
  11. Bean-Managed Persistence Entity Beans
  12. EJB Security and Transactions

Prerequisites

You should have a solid Java programming background before taking this course. Prior J2EE experience not necessary.
